**Ticket: DGR-214 — Undo/Redo in SketchLoom**

Undo stack in the SketchLoom diagram editor drops grouped-shape operations. Redo then replays a partial state and corrupts connectors. Fix: treat group transforms as single history entries. Include regression tests for nested groups. Do not merge without sign-off. Contractors: no direct pushes to the history module. Sign-off must come from the engineer named below.

account owner for bawip-tahag: Raleth Quenok

09:41 — The Millgate queue-depth autoscaler began oscillating after a plugin reported negative depth values, which the clamp logic didn't handle. Scale-downs fired during peak load, doubling dequeue latency for roughly eleven minutes. Plugin authors: depth callbacks must now return non-negative integers, and the host rejects anything else starting with this release. We added contract tests to the plugin SDK. The fixed host build is identified by the token below.

session token of tajef-bageg = htk21_5d90d574934f3ccae6437

# Artifact Signing — Bulk Edits in the Ledgerpane Admin Table

For this week's eng sync: all artifacts produced by bulk edits in the Ledgerpane admin table must now be signed before promotion. When an operator selects multiple rows and applies a batch change, the export job bundles the diff into a tarball and submits it to the Corvette signing service. Verify the manifest hash matches the table snapshot before approving. Unsigned bundles are rejected at the gateway. The current signing key for batch exports is listed below.

rollout seal: bky9_PeXH1fTLY